The Czech Academy of Sciences (CAS) recently concluded the most detailed and demanding evaluation of the the Biology Centre’s (BC) research and professional activities. International evaluators checked the results of 19 teams from BC for the years 2010 to 2014. The result? All teams have succeeded and six of these are rated excellent, world-class teams.
On Friday, May 6, 2016 a distinguished Czech hydrobiologist, prof. RNDr. Pavel Blažka, DrSc passed away. He was born in 1928. Since 1960 he was employed at the Czechoslovak Academy of Sciences and in 1981 he moved to České Budějovice. Until 2001 he was employed as a research associate at the Institute of Hydrobiology. Professor Karel Šimek received Honorary Gregor Johann Mendel Medal for Merits in the biological sciences. The medal was awarded to him by the President of the Academy of Sciences prof. Jiri Drahos.
